Ingredients: 1/2 cup melted butter 3/4 cup sugar 2 eggs well beaten 2 teaspoons vanilla 1 cup flour 1/2 teaspoon baking powder 3/4 cup chopped dried apricot Instructions: Preheat oven to 350 degrees Pans needed: 13 by 9 inch greased baking pan. Combine ingredients in order given in a medium sized bowl beat till all ingredients are thoroughly combined but be careful not to over beat. Pour batter into greased pan and bake for 20-25 minutes, cake will be lightly golden brown and center should bounce back when touched, when done remove from oven and let pan cool on rack. When cooled cut cake into the size squares that you desire. This recipe can be doubled and baked in a larger pan. |
